Every successful business, despite its size or industry, relies on a set of fundamental functions to operate effectively. These functions are the cornerstones that drive growth, profitability, and overall success.
A key function is marketing, which focuses on reaching customers and advertising products or services. Another crucial function is sales, responsible for converting leads into paying clients. Operations manage the day-to-day activities of producing goods or delivering services, ensuring smoothness.
The finance department handles the monetary aspects of the business, including accounting, budgeting resources, and overseeing investments. Finally, human personnel focuses on hiring and retaining talent to support the business's goals.
These functions are integrated, working together in a harmonious manner to achieve the overall purpose of the business. Understanding and effectively executing these fundamental functions is essential for any business seeking to thrive in today's competitive environment.
